Understanding Car Keys

Modern car keys have actually developed significantly from the standard metal keys. Comprehending these various key types is essential for vehicle owners.

Kinds Of Car Keys

  1. Standard Key:

    • Made of metal and utilized to physically engage the locks.
    • Simple and simple to replace but does not have security features.
  2. Transponder Key:

    • Contains a microchip that interacts with the car's ignition system.
    • Offers an added layer of security, as the car will not begin without the right transponder key.
  3. Smart Key (Key Fob):

    • Allows for keyless entry and ignition through proximity sensors.
    • Often includes additional functionalities, such as remote start and panic buttons.
  4. Valet Key:

    • A minimal gain access to key developed for use by parking attendants.
    • Normally restricts access to the trunk and glove compartment.
  5. Remote Keyless Entry:

    • Operates door locks, trunk release, and other functions from a distance.
    • Often combined with transponder chips for enhanced security.
Key TypeSecurity LevelAdditional Features
Standard KeyLowNone
Transponder KeyModerateChip for ignition lock
Smart Key/Key FobHighKeyless entry and remote start
Valet KeyModerateMinimal gain access to
Remote Keyless EntryHighRemote operation of locks and features

The Cost of Replacement Keys

The expense of replacement keys can differ significantly based upon numerous aspects, such as vehicle make and model, key type, and where the replacement is gotten. Below is a general breakdown of costs connected with various types of keys.

Key TypeEstimated Cost (GBP)
Traditional Key₤ 5 - ₤ 30
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 200
Smart Key/Key Fob₤ 200 - ₤ 600
Valet Key₤ 10 - ₤ 50
Remote Keyless Entry₤ 150 - ₤ 400

The costs for keys normally consist of the following components:

  • Key Cutting: The preliminary expense tied to the physical cutting of the key.
  • Programs: For transponder and wise keys, additional programs costs might be incurred to sync the key with the vehicle's system.
  • Service Fees: If how do you get a replacement key for your car opt for a locksmith professional or car dealership, service costs will likewise use.

Where to Get Replacement Keys

Getting a replacement key can be done through various channels, each with its own set of pros and cons:

  1. Automobile Dealerships:

    • Pros: Accurate programming and initial keys.
    • Cons: Typically the most costly alternative.
  2. Professional Locksmiths:

    • Pros: Often more budget-friendly and can accomplish internal programs for lots of kinds of keys.
    • Cons: Limited access to state-of-the-art keys, depending on the locksmith's devices.
  3. Automotive Service Centers:

    • Pros: Competitive prices and experienced technicians.
    • Cons: May not supply services for all key types.
  4. Online Retailers:

    • Pros: Usually, the cheapest alternative for key blanks and cutting services.
    • Cons: Requires DIY programs, which can be intricate.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How can I tell if my key has a chip?

If your key has a plastic head or a minor curve, it is likely a transponder key, which typically has a chip embedded within it.

2. Can I get a replacement key for a car that is no longer in production?

Yes, you can often find replacement keys for older or discontinued designs through specialized locksmiths or online retailers. Nevertheless, accessibility might vary based on the car's age and model.

3. Is it safe to purchase keys online?

Buying keys online can be safe, but always make sure the merchant is trustworthy and offers protected payment options. Additionally, be prepared to set the key yourself, if needed.

4. How can I program a new key for my car?

The approach for programming a new key differs by make and design. Common techniques include turning the key in the ignition while following specific patterns or utilizing an OBD-II programmer.
